Visual Studio Code 在 Windows、Mac 及 Linux 的使用介紹
對開發人員來說,這是個多麼美好的時代啊。在舊金山的 BUILD 發布會上,微軟剛剛推出了 Visual Studio Code -- 一個用於 Windows、Mac 和Linux 操作系統的優化 code 編輯器,它是 Visual Studio 家族的新成員。
Visual Studio Code 是一種新的免費開發工具。是一個 code 編輯器,但非常聰明。它能夠跨平台,用 TypeScript 和 Electron 建構,並且可以在 Windows、 Mac 和 Linux 上運行。
Visual Studio Code 可以使用多種程式語言,常規語言如: CoffeeScript、Python、Ruby、Jade、Clojure、Java、C++、R、Go、makefile,shell scripts、 PowerShell、 bat、xml。它不僅僅只是自動完成,還擁有真正的智能感知能力。對於單個文件像 HTML、 CSS、LESS、 SASS 和 Markdown ,也具有智能感知功能。現在 Visual Studio Code 支援的語系非常多。
這個編輯器的最強大的功能其實是針對 C#、 TypeScript、 JavaScript/node、JSON 等工程項目的智能感知。例如,當您在 Visual Studio Code 中正在編輯 ASP.NET 5 應用程序時,Open Source 上 Roslyn 和 OmniSharp 將會為 Visual Studio Code 提供智能感知,這意味著你可以得到真正的智能重構、導航,還有更多! Visual Studio Code 對於 TypeScript 的支持是強大的,因為在它的核心部分有 JavaScript 和 TypeScript 的支持。
Visual Studio Code 具有 git 支持 、 diff 命令、Gulp 的可擴展性模式,對於 JavaScript 和 Nodejs 的應用程式來說,它是一個極度能幫助 debug 的工具。我們正在努力在所有平台上支持像是 .NET Core CLR 和 Mono 這樣的內容。
這是一個注重 code 和 code 優化的輕量級工具,不完全只是 IDE。如果您常常使用命令行,那麼一定要試試這個免費工具。
您可以在這裡下載 Visual Studio Code ! >> https://code.visualstudio.com
下載 Visual Studio Code,並看看教學文件,還有 ASP.NET 和 Node.js 相關的資料。現在的 Visual Studio Code 只是一個預覽版,但是它會按照星期不斷的發展更新。
以下有一些 Visual Studio Code 的截圖,它們一定可以吸引您的目光!無論您喜歡使用什麼樣的開發語言或是在什麼樣的平台上運行,都可以使用 Visual Studio Code(他還支持 Azure J 呢!)。
在此祝您 Coding 愉快 !!
原文發表於:Introducing Visual Studio Code for Windows, Mac, and Linux